There have been extraordinary changes in medicine since the start of the 20th Century.

Diseases that were killers in 1900, such as polio, have been almost wiped out.

Hundreds of new drugs have been developed. This book shows how today's extraordinary surgical techniques, such as heart transplants, would have been unthinkable for a doctor a hundred years ago. And, unlike 1900, people in many countries today can see a doctor or other healthcare worker when they need to, often for free.
